Extracellular Vesicle In article 2400885, Yifan Wang, Shangjing Xin, and co‐workers present multifunctional extracellular vesicle (EV) crosslinkers for constructing bio‐functional hydrogels. EVs are versatile functionalized for hydrogel formation via common chemistries, imparting stress‐relaxation and enabling delivery of bioactive proteins.
